At Juta, we take pride in celebrating the achievements of our team members who continuously strive to make a difference in their fields. Today, we are delighted to shine a spotlight on Rhea Morar, our Compliance Manager, who has been elected Chairperson of the Copyright Committee for the Publishers Association of South Africa (PASA).
This appointment highlights Rhea’s dedication to advancing copyright protection and innovation within the publishing industry. Copyright is often referred to as the cornerstone of creative industries, both locally and globally. It safeguards the rights of creators, fosters innovation, and ensures fair reward for intellectual labour.
Rhea’s journey with Juta has not only equipped her with in-depth expertise in this evolving field but also provided a platform to champion the cause of copyright.
Speaking about her new role, Rhea said:
"Copyright is, arguably, the cornerstone of any creative industry both at home and on the global level. This role is not something that I take lightly. I look forward to working with my colleagues and other bodies to educate, learn, and grow in this area."
We are incredibly proud of Rhea’s achievement and confident that her leadership will bring fresh perspectives and meaningful advancements to the field.
